30 Fixed a crash or incorrect output during LZMS compression with a
31 compression level greater than 50 and a chunk size greater than 64 MiB.
32 This affected wimlib v1.8.0 and later. In the unlikely event that you
33 used all these non-default compression settings in combination, e.g.
34 'wimcapture --solid --solid-compress=LZMS:100 --solid-chunk-size=128M',
35 run 'wimverify' on your archives to verify your data is intact.

87 Fixed a data corruption bug (incorrect compression) when storing an
88 already highly-compressed file in an LZX-compressed WIM with a chunk
89 size greater than or equal to 64K. Note that this is not the default
90 setting and such WIMs are not supported by Microsoft's WIM software, so
91 only users who used the --chunk-size option to wimlib-imagex or the
92 wimlib_set_output_chunk_size() API function may have been affected.
93 This bug was introduced in wimlib v1.10.0. See
94 https://wimlib.net/forums/viewtopic.php?f=1&t=300 for more details.

364 The compression chunk size in solid resources, e.g. when capturing or
365 exporting a WIM file using the '--solid' option, now defaults to 64 MiB
366 (67108864 bytes) instead of 32 MiB (33554432 bytes). This provides a
367 better compression ratio and is the same value that WIMGAPI uses. The
368 memory usage is less than 50% higher than wimlib v1.7.4 and is slightly
369 lower than WIMGAPI's memory usage, but if it is too much, it is still
370 possible to choose a lower value, e.g. with the '--solid-chunk-size'
371 option to wimlib-imagex.

651 Support for extracting and updating the new version 3584 WIMs has been
652 added. These WIMs typically pack many streams ("files") together into a
653 single compressed resource, thereby saving space. This degrades the
654 performance of random access (such as that which occurs on a mounted
655 image), but optimizations have been implemented for extraction. These
656 new WIM files also typically use a new compression format (LZMS), which
657 is similar to LZMA and can offer a better compression ratio than LZX.
658 These new WIM files can be created using `wimcapture' with
659 the '--compress=lzms --pack-streams' options. Note: this new WIM format
660 is used by the Windows 8 web downloader, but important segments of the
661 raw '.esd' files are encrypted, so wimlib will not be able to extract
662 such files until they are first decrypted.

679 Support for compression chunk sizes greater than the default of 32768
680 bytes has been added. A larger chunk size typically results in a better
681 compression ratio. However, the MS implementation is seemingly not
682 compatible with all chunk sizes, especially for LZX compression, so the
683 defaults remain unchanged, with the exception of the new LZMS-compressed
684 WIMs, which use a larger chunk size by default.

1025 Microsoft has managed to introduce even more bugs into their software,
1026 and now the WIMs for Windows 8 have incorrect (too low) reference counts
1027 for some streams. This is unsafe because such streams can be removed
1028 when they are in actuality still referenced in the WIM (perhaps by a
1029 different image). wimlib will now work around this problem by fixing
1030 the stream reference counts. This is only done when wimlib_delete_image() is
1031 called ('imagex delete') or when wimlib_mount_image() is called with
1032 WIMLIB_MOUNT_FLAG_READWRITE ('imagex mountrw'). Please note that this
1033 requires reading the metadata for all images in the WIM, so this will
1034 make these operations noticably slower on WIMs with multiple images.
